Why teams choose us
Live streaming app development is what we are known for. We build TikTok-Live-style white-label platforms and audio live room apps — multi-guest video rooms, gifting economies, mini-games, agency hierarchies, admin panels and moderation tools — the pieces that separate a demo from a business.
Our clients are streaming founders in South Asia, MENA and beyond who need the whole product, not a features list. We design the app, build the Flutter client, run the Go backend, and own the real-time layer underneath. We also run our own real-time infrastructure platform, Gravix Cloud, and our own 2D web games platform, Gravix Game — so your live streaming platform development ships on battle-tested systems our own products depend on.

What's included
Multi-guest video & audio rooms
Spaces where thousands join, thousands watch, and the stream stays sub-second responsive.
Gifting & virtual economy
Coins, bundles, gifts and leaderboards wired into validated payment flows.
Agency & streamer hierarchy
Agents recruit, streamers earn, admins moderate — all in the same system.
Admin & moderation suite
Real-time moderation, reports, bans and dashboards that your ops team will actually use.
Live streaming platform development end-to-end
Discovery, monetisation, notifications and compliance — one team, one timeline.
Launch-night reliability
Load tests, war-room coverage and the capacity planning that other agencies skip.
